RCS-4 N-pentanoic acid metabolite is a synthetic cannabinoid which is structurally similar to JWH 018. Like JWH 018, RCS-4 has been detected in herbal products. RCS-4 N-(5-carboxypentyl) metabolite is an expected metabolite of RCS-4. Carboxylation of the N-alkyl chain of JWH 018 occurs during in vivo metabolism, resulting in a 5-carboxypentyl metabolite that is detectable in the urine.
